Our girly friend, Janis, sent us this yummy recipe: Warning: Don’t try to pronounce it, just make it. Trust me, you’ll love it!
This is a baking recipe…sort of quiche like but not all eggy and bland.  It is a perfect brunch dish or vegetarian dinner.
Prejesnas (Pre-Hes-Nas) I have no idea where the name comes from I have Googled it to no avail. Recipe was handed down to me from my Aunt, she got it from a college roommate.
So here goes:
1 cup flour
1/2 tsp. salt
1 tsp. baking powder
1/2 lb cheddar cheese, grated
1 c. milk
1/2 medium onion, diced fine
2 eggs, slightly beaten
1/2 bunch fresh spinach, or 1 pkg frozen (thawed)
1/2 c. melted margarine
Mix dry ingredients, add beaten eggs, milk, melted margarine, and stir. (I like using a wooden spoon to get the lumps out.)
Add cheese, chopped spinach and onion. Pour into greased 12X7 pan. Bake @ 375 degrees for 35 minutes.
FYI: I tend to feed a lot of people so I double this entire recipe (using a whole bag of packaged fresh Spinach), pour into a 9X13 casserole dish and cook for about 50 minutes, until nice & golden on the top.
Occasionally I get extra creative and and chopped bacon bits if it’s for brunch, or fresh sliced mushrooms…you get the idea
